    Pylos is a bit different than some Greek resorts that I have stayed at in so much that it is a Greek town that caters for tourism, rather than a tourist resort. Its a working town that retains its population with a marina, hardware shops and the like. Most of the people you meet are Greek as apposed to tourists although it is popular with German tourists. Whereas comfortable sunbed apartment / hotels based around a pool are very much the norm elsewhere I have stayed in Greece, they are not here. I stayed here for 6 nights and liked it very much. Its still very pretty with a bustling town square near the harbour with plenty of restaurants and cafes. Has lovely views across the bay. It felt a bit more 'real' in the sense of a Greek experience.

    You have access to the following places which are worth visiting. The beautiful beach of Voidokilia. The beautiful nature reserve of Divari with its beautiful assortment of plants and bird life. The castle above Voidokilia and the the castle above the town of Pylos are both worth visiting. You can dine in the fantastic sea restaurants of Pylos and the nearby Gialova restaurants. If you are a golf player there are 4 superb golf courses which are run by the Costa Navarino resort.
